(57) [Abstract] [Purpose] By using an iron equipped with the function of spraying a wrinkle-proofing agent, the agent that directly reacts with the fibers is sprinkled on the cotton garment, and by further heating and pressing with this iron, Wrinkles can be prevented without ironing each time it is washed. [Structure] 5% to 20% of a glyoxal resin is used as an aqueous solution of a wrinkle-preventing agent and sprayed onto clothes, and a crosslinking reaction between cellulose of the resin is performed at a curing temperature of 160 ° C to 190 ° C. [Effect] It is not necessary to iron each time after washing, and wrinkles do not occur even after washing about 20 times, and simple anti-wrinkle processing can be performed.

Description of the Related Art The usage rate of cotton in cotton products or cotton blended products is as high as 40% or more of the total fibers, and it tends to increase more and more in the future. Under these circumstances, there is a problem that cotton products such as shirts are easily wrinkled, and many clothing manufacturers are trying to prevent wrinkles. Recently, anti-wrinkles such as VP processing, SSP processing and DA processing have been tried. Due to the development of processing technology, cotton products, which are characterized by being worn without iron after washing, are on the market.

ワの発生を押さえることができる。In order to achieve the above object, the present invention uses a resin that directly cross-links with the cellulose of the cotton fiber, and uses an amorphous portion of the cellulose that causes wrinkles of the fiber. Is configured to reinforce, and wrinkles can be suppressed by this configuration.

A glyoxal-based resin aqueous solution is formed into a mist by a steam generator provided in an iron, sprayed onto clothes, and heat and pressure are applied while being dried with an iron, thereby applying glyoxal-based fibers between cellulose fibers. Since a cross-linking reaction with the resin occurs and the space between the cellulose is reinforced, the generation of wrinkles is suppressed, and the anti-wrinkle effect can be generated.

る。First, an aqueous solution of a glyoxal resin as a wrinkle-preventing agent is placed in a container 1, the temperature of an iron is raised and water 2 is added to generate steam in a steam chamber 4 and jet it from a nozzle 5. By this, a decompressed state is created, and the processing aqueous solution is sucked up into fine water droplets, which are sprayed onto the clothes. The nozzle 5 has a structure in which the angle can be changed,
It is devised so that the sprayed state is properly irradiated to the clothes.

よりシワのできにくい状態を形成することができる。Next, the clothes uniformly sprayed with the aqueous processing agent solution are dried at a low temperature of 80 ° C. or lower, and then the temperature of the iron is raised to 160 to 190 ° C. to apply heat while stretching the wrinkles. It is possible to form a wrinkle-resistant state by directly cross-linking a certain glyoxal resin with cellulose which is the main component of the fiber.

地が悪くなり使用できなくなる。The wrinkle-preventing effect and washing durability of the cotton product which has been subjected to the above-mentioned method will be described with reference to FIG. FIG. 4 shows the results obtained by changing the concentration of the glyoxal-based resin in the range of 3 to 20%. When the concentration of the glyoxal-based resin is 3%, the wrinkle-preventing effect is not so great, but the effect is sufficient in the range of 5% to 20%. It is within the usable range. On the other hand, if it exceeds 20%, although the anti-wrinkle effect is obtained, the clothes themselves become hard and uncomfortable to wear and cannot be used.
